nothing less then 0 gauge OFC wire if you plan on pushing 2 Xcons. Have you done the big 3? What are your voltages reading at? Also your amp choices coulda been a lot better, none of those amps can even come close to powering two Xcons... Scratch that it wont even fully push a single Xcon 12. Most likely your subs are D2 wired in parallel and those cheap amps cant handle a half ohm load along with low voltages its a recipe for disaster.

Well not gona get much of anything decent for a cpl hundred ...esp with having to ditch that box and upgrade wiring/batteries

 
you should stray away from those junk brands of amps, they seem like a good deal on a budget but your actually sinking more money than necessary buying pretty much bricks and doorstops. Might want to let your budget grow and either get two 2k rms amps, one for each xcon, or a single QUALITY amp that can handle a half ohm load.

For budget 0 gauge wiring look up audiotechnix or execution audio

for amps, best in price and performance ratio would be crescendo bc 3500, soundqubed/audioque 3500 (i know its a lot but well worth the money, so save up)
